Kick It by Eliza for MISSBISH

January 20, 2017

I met Eliza Shirazi of Kick It By Eliza at Everybody Fights hidden in the Seaport District of Boston. The gym gave me major Dogpound vibes. She geared up with her gloves and Kick It New Balance gear. Eliza showed me what it takes to be a part of the kick it crew in the ring.

Jab. Jab. Jab.

High kick!

Eliza's energy and inspiration is contagious. It's evident by the many greetings of the other gym attendees. One girl brings her father up to Eliza to introduce them and tell her father what a difference Eliza's class has made on her. Mixing portraiture, fitness and lifestyle, I was able to capture the many sides of Eliza and her inner MISSBISH.  

"MISSBISH means being the most kick ass version of yourself."

Bari Studio for HBFit

September 11, 2015

Hannah Bronfman and HBFit hosted a class at the Bari studio in Tribeca to jump start Fashion Week. As a bari newbie, I photographed in awe at how exciting the class was. I silently jammed to Justin Bieber's "What Do You Mean?" when it came on. 

The class was just as much about the body as it was about the mind. The last 30 minutes of the class are spent meditating, breathing and changing the energy of the room.

The class talked about triggers. The instructor encouraged us to breath and take in the moment every time we hear the word fashion this week. Be present.

I love jobs where the experience is more than just shooting. And this was one of them.

Duality of Activewear for HBFit

September 9, 2015

This is the perfect way to kick off fashion week.

I recently photographed six outfits two ways for a blog post on HBFit. All activewear shown either in a pretty feminine or a tomboy edgier look. We walked around NYC stumbling upon a colorful ice cream truck and garage doors, which made perfect backdrops to the fitness lifestyle outfits.  

Kicking my health start into gear, I immediately went to Juice Generation for a smoothie after the photoshoot. I plan to live a more HBFit lifestyle and pray it helps me make it through the chaos that is New York Fashion Week.
